>> OOP is, essentially, about encapsulation and late binding.  (Forget
>> classes, inheritance, etc, for a moment: they're not essential.)
>> Encapsulation means that when you access data in an object you do it
>> via the set of routines (aka methods) that object provides.  I'm sure
>> that you know what late binding means already.

"decision hiding" is certainly not standard terminology.

> I have no idea what "late binding" is.

I suspect you're familiar with the concept, though.  It can be as
simple as a few pointers at the start of the data; all a caller needs
to know is that you EXECUTE them to access the data.  It's called
"late binding" because the call isn't bound to any particular target
until execution time.  This is distinct from "early binding" where you
know at compile time exactly where a call is going to go.

> The real question is "what is better about OOP that I can't do in a
> language without OOP"?  I can implement all these concepts without
> OOP as far as I can tell.

No, you can't do that without OOP, because those concepts *are* OOP.
Do that consistently. and you're object-oriented programming.  You
don't need an object-oriented language: that's purely a matter of
notation.  But notation is important.  Turing famously was quite happy
to read a display backwards in binary, but everyone else found it
inconvenient.

>> Alan Kay has talked about the first instance of this, which was
>> around 1960.  NASA had some data on a tape, but that tape was in a
>> special binary format.  So, there was the problem of how to decode
>> the data, and how to document the format.  There was also the
>> problem that when the data format changed, you'd have to document
>> that, and change the programs that read it, and maybe have some
>> sort of version number on that tape.  A program reading the tape
>> would have first to read the version number, then call right one of
>> a bunch of routines for that data.  Somebody had a truly brilliant
>> idea, one of the best in the history of computer science: put the
>> routines for decoding the data at the start of the tape.  So, when
>> a program needed to analyze the data, it first loaded the routines
>> at the start of the tape, and then called those routines to read
>> the data.
